Industry Landscape and Emerging Challenges
Recent reports from the European Gaming and Betting Association indicate that online gambling revenue reached €20.7 billion in 2022, with mobile platforms accounting for over 70% of total bets. While this growth underscores expanding market opportunities, it also accentuates the importance of responsible gambling measures amid concerns about compulsive behaviors and addiction.
Regulators across various jurisdictions, including the UK Gambling Commission, have responded by enforcing stricter compliance protocols, which often include mandatory self-exclusion schemes, deposit limits, and real-time monitoring. Yet, technological solutions are increasingly central to proactive harm minimization, offering personalized intervention tools that adapt to individual risk profiles.
Leveraging Technology for Ethical Engagement
Modern operators leverage data analytics, artificial intelligence (AI), and machine learning to identify early warning signs in player behaviour, enabling preemptive engagement. For example, anomalies such as rapid bet frequency, increased deposit levels, or irregular session times can trigger automated prompts or operator alerts. This dynamic approach to player monitoring surpasses traditional, reactive strategies.
Platforms like GamCare provide comprehensive behavioral frameworks that integrate seamlessly with licensed operators’ systems. Notably, the use of personalized messaging—offering self-assessment tools or cooling-off options—has been shown to reduce harmful behaviours effectively.
